With Lux, none of the candles or wall torches are emitting any light. And only half of the braziers (at most) in dungeons lack any light even though they are burning.

All the patches plugins are at the bottom of my LO, and according to TESEdit, nothing is overwriting them. The left window of MO also shows that nothing is overwriting the mods. I did have to select the "more brightness" to be able to be in dungeons without a torch.

 

This is breaking my immersion. Anyone else had this issue? Also, if nothing else work, can someone recommend a lighting mod that plays well with Community Shaders?

Here is my LO mif it helps: https://pastebin.com/LcZLcsh8 

EDIT: SOLVED! I was missing CS Lights, which was nowhere in the requirement list for any of the mods that I had wiuth CS.

2 minutes ago, kanne28 said:

The left window of MO also shows that nothing is overwriting the mods.

 

Plugin record conflicts do not show up here. You need xEdit for that.

 

3 minutes ago, kanne28 said:

Anyone else had this issue?

 

With LUX? No, I don't use it. But Skyrim is quite limited when it comes to light sources, especially those that emit shadows. My guess would be one or a combination of the following:

  1. You're missing CS and/or Light Limit Fix, or LUX doesn't make use of it.
  2. You're missing Light Placer, or LUX doesn't utilize it.
  3. You're missing ENB Lights, or LUX doesn't use it.
